Dropping inputs should only happen when the game is slowing down, and even then very seldom. Slowdown only happens when your opponent’s inputs are very far behind, and you must have the worst internet in the world if that’s happening to you on the patched version. (^.^) If you hold the button for slightly longer it’ll never drop 'em anyway.

As for giving you 5 frame hold = press, HELL NO. That’s BB-style L2P territory and it changes a lot about the metagame. You’ve already got a 4f reversal window, a 5f chain buffer window, and a 5f jump buffer window. At some point ya still gotta hit the buttons at nearly the right time. :^P

@Dime - If you are getting slowdown with the patch, your delay to your opponent is more than 14 frames. At that point, no amount of clever networking technology can save you. Besides, under the conditions where an input is dropped, it isn’t registered at all…so even if there were a buffer it wouldn’t do you any good.
